怀旧服远程服务器搭建全攻略,三步开启专属世界,怀旧服远程服务器搭建指南,三步打造个性化游戏世界
一、开服方式选择:哪种适合你?
核心问题:零基础玩家也能自建服务器吗?
答案是肯定的。根据硬件条件和需求,主流有三种方案:
复制1. **局域网联机方案**(适合新手) - 工具:Hamachi虚拟局域网[2,3](@ref) - 流程:创建网络组→分享IP给好友→游戏内直连 - 优势:免公网IP/零成本2. **一键开服器方案**(平衡型选择) - 操作:下载开服器→解压到游戏根目录→配置参数启动[2,4](@ref) - 关键配置:地图文件路径、玩家数据存储方式3. **专业服务器方案**(高并发需求) - 硬件:租用VPS或独立主机[2,6](@ref) - 系统推荐:Windows Server 2012 R2[6](@ref) - 必装环境:.NET框架/数据库组件[6](@ref)
真实案例:某玩家用方案2搭建40人服,月耗仅35元
二、环境搭建实战:以魔兽怀旧服为例
核心问题:如何三分钟完成基础配置?
Step1 核心文件部署
- 下载服务端压缩包(含authServer/worldServer)
- 修改数据库表
realmlist
的address字段为服务器IP

Step2 端口映射关键操作
步骤 | 操作位置 | 参数设置 |
---|---|---|
1 | 路由器管理页 | 登录192.168.1.1 |
2 | 转发规则 | 添加TCP端口3724/8085 |
3 | DHCP服务器 | 绑定主机MAC地址 |
Step3 服务启动顺序
- 运行PHPStudy启动数据库
- 启动authServer验证服务
- 运行worldServer主进程
注意:首次启动需同意EULA协议
三、远程管理命令大全
核心问题:如何不登录服务器实时管控?
通过SSH远程连接后,这些命令让你掌控全局:
复制► **玩家管理** - 查看在线:`who`[1](@ref) - 踢出违规者:`.kick 玩家名`[1](@ref)► **服务器运维** - 紧急关服:`.shutdown 60`(60秒倒计时)[1](@ref) - 广播通知:`.announce "维护通知"`[1](@ref)► **文件传输技巧** - 上传配置:`scp /local/config.conf user@ip:/server/path`[1](@ref) - 下载日志:`scp user@ip:/logs/error.log ./`[1](@ref)
四、避坑指南与安全加固
核心问题:为什么玩家连不上我的服务器?
三大致命错误你中招了吗:
复制❗ **防火墙拦截** - 解决方案:放行TCP 3724/8085+UDP 27015端口[3](@ref)❗ **IP动态变化** - 应对措施:使用DDNS动态域名服务❗ **权限配置错误** - 正确流程: 1. 黑框窗口输入`account set gmlevel 账号名 3 -1`[6](@ref) 2. 重启服务生效
个人实战经验:曾因未绑定MAC地址导致连续48小时掉线,固定IP是稳定运行的灵魂。建议开服首周设置每日自动备份(
.saveall
命令),避免数据意外丢失。当看到第一个玩家成功进入自建服的瞬间,你会明白这些折腾都值得——那不只是服务器,而是我们共同青春的复刻之地。